Solve (300/m) + 44n where m = 15 and n = 4
[tex]\begin{gathered} (\frac{300}{m})+44n \\ \text{Substitute for the values of m and n, and you have;} \\ (\frac{300}{15})+44(4) \\ 20+176 \\ 196 \end{gathered}[/tex]
The solution to the expression is 196
